    Effective Voting Strategies Amidst a Competitive Candidate Field

    With numerous contenders vying for votes, it is vital for the electorate to adopt a strategic approach to casting ballots. Prioritizing issues that align with personal values and community priorities can help voters make informed choices. Engaging deeply with candidates’ platforms—through official communications, debates, and public forums—allows for a clearer understanding beyond campaign rhetoric. Additionally, monitoring endorsements and grassroots support can provide insight into a candidate’s broader appeal and potential effectiveness.

    Key tactics to enhance your voting decision include:

    • Identify your top priorities: Narrow down the three most important issues guiding your vote.
    • Consult trusted sources: Seek perspectives from local leaders and experts to gain nuanced insights.
    • Review track records: Examine candidates’ past performance to evaluate consistency and credibility.
    Voting TipReasoning
    Focus on Local ConcernsEnsures elected officials address the immediate needs of your community.
    Diversify Information SourcesHelps counteract misinformation and broadens your understanding.
    Attend or Stream Candidate EventsProvides firsthand insight into candidates’ communication and policy clarity.
